Abstract
The invention discloses a kind of automatic winding planting greenhouses, including Greenhouse, greenhouse frame, support frame, connect slide bar, the middle part bottom end of the greenhouse frame fixedly supports support frame, the upper surface of greenhouse frame it is longitudinally fixed more connection slide bars, greenhouse frame, support frame and connection slide bar constitute the general frame of a greenhouse, the left and right ends of greenhouse frame and the bottom end of support frame are all fixedly supported on ground, one layer is covered with right above support frame, Greenhouse is fixedly linked by carriage with slide bar is connect, the stretching device for being equipped with driving Greenhouse and being moved forward and backward of the front and back of carriage;Greenhouse whole slide by being fastened in the connection slide bar on greenhouse frame by the present invention, Greenhouse sliding back and forth on big ceiling may be implemented, the winding motor case and expansion motor housing of setting can realize automatic winding and the expansion of Greenhouse by stretching device, and the speed of Greenhouse disassembly is greatly saved.

Background technique
Green house of vegetables is a kind of frame structure of film with outstanding thermal insulation property, it occurs that people are had
Vegetables in improper season.General green house of vegetables is covered with one or more layers insulating plastic pipe using bamboo structure or the skeleton of steel construction above
Film, material is thus formed a greenhouse spaces.Outer membrane prevents the loss of carbon dioxide caused by internal vegetable growth well,
Make that there is good heat insulation effect in canopy.Due to this structure of film of green house of vegetables, when encountering high wind heavy rain or hail heavy snow
When equal bad weathers, the windage that Greenhouse is subject to is larger, is easy one piece of big-canopy framework of drive and is blown down by high wind, and overlay film one
As quality it is softer, be easy by hail or heavy snow be collapsed, therefore, in strong convective weather, peasant requires to carry out greenhouse urgent
It reinforces or directly rolls Greenhouse and greenhouse is protected.
Generally very complicated to the disassembly of Greenhouse, overlay film is all that multiple spot is fixed on keel, so in disassembly overlay film
When, it needs to disassemble each fixed point, very take time and effort, for the weather that happens suddenly, large area greenhouse often has little time
Disassembly, causes huge economic losses, therefore, for this problem, it would be desirable to which one kind can quickly carry out Greenhouse fast
The planting greenhouse of speed dismounting.

The working principle of the invention is: when work, when needing quickly winding Greenhouse 1, opening in take-up motor housing 6
Take-up motor 61, take-up motor 61 drive motor reel 62 rotate, motor reel 62 by guide pulley 65 will wind
Line 9 opens up winding, and the dragging winding connecting rod 42 of winding wire 9 being fixed in winding string holes 43 is provided with sliding in winding sliding slot 40
Dynamic, then Greenhouse 1 is whole is pulled to 6 side of take-up motor housing, until connection gasket 45 is moved to close to take-up motor housing 6 one
The take-up motor 61 in take-up motor housing 6 is closed in the position of side, then Greenhouse 1 just realizes quick winding movement, works as needs
When there is expansion Greenhouse 1, the take-up motor 61 in expansion motor housing 5 is opened, then the fixed winding wire 9 in 44 end of string holes is unfolded
Greenhouse 1 is pulled open to the position of the expansion motor housing 5 of rear side, Greenhouse 1 is covered on again on big ceiling, complete as a result,
At the automatic winding and expansion function of greenhouse.
